From 3:10 am on Mondays to midnight past, the ticket office keeps the station vibrating with life, offering ticket buying and collection services. For tech-savvy travellers, smartcard capabilities are present, complete with validators. Additionally, there's a self-service ticket machine to collect previously purchased tickets, ensuring you’re all set for your train adventures.
Accessibility is a top priority at Liverpool Street. You'll find step-free access throughout, complete with lifts and escalators to take you to the bus station and adjacent shopping areas. For those needing assistance, we recommend contacting the mobility service in advance to ensure seamless support. Plus, with an induction loop system, accessible toilets, and customer help points, the station welcomes everyone warmly and ensures all can travel confidently.
When it comes to refueling, whether it's the mind or the body, you're in luck. Grab a coffee to-go, relax in a public house or bar, or dine at food outlets with or without seating. While you wait, take advantage of the lounges and waiting areas. First-class passengers can also enjoy an exclusive lounge.
London Liverpool Street isn't just a final stop. It's your launchpad to the city's wide transport network. Taxis can be hailed from the rank along platform 10, and several bus services, equipped with step-free access, can be boarded right outside. For those heading underground, the Central, Circle, Hammersmith & City, and Metropolitan lines weave throughout London. If you're flying out, Stansted Express takes you directly to the airport—a breeze for any jet setter!

Kempston Hardwick may be small, but it serves as a vital link for travelers heading to various UK locales. When traveling from this station, it's crucial to keep in mind that there isn’t a ticket office or ticket collection machine. Although tickets need to be purchased online or at other stations, the station does feature valuable resources like departure screens and customer help points. While not staffed directly, it offers a help point for information and a customer service contact center that's eager to assist during regular hours.
Accessibility is partially catered for with step-free access available to parts of the station. However, while planning your trip, note that there are no accessible facilities such as toilets or waiting rooms, yet a seating area is available for a brief respite while you wait for your train.
Despite its rural setting, Kempston Hardwick offers some essential transport services to ensure your journey continues seamlessly. When rail services are halted, replacement buses are at the ready from the gravel turning circle, located near the entrance to the Bletchley-bound platform. If you're planning to explore further afield, resources to help plan your onward journey by bus can be accessed in a convenient and printable format here.
